      I think there are quite a bit more years of engineering time invested in Unreal Engine than Steam, so 5% for that seems like a much better deal than 30% for a storefront, even after deducting the store’s operating costs of maybe 7%.

          Costs will go down further as we automate the systems enable developers to fully maintain their own game pages. The operating cost of new features is tiny compared to the costs of payment processing and CDN bandwidth for downloading patches.

          And generally, if you look at all of the tools and services that developers spend money on, they’re all far better deals than stores - Unreal, Unity, Perforce, Maya, AWS. None mark up their development and operating costs by anything like 4x-5x like 30% stores do.
